He slowly raised one hand to take the water bag, but Jinghe brought the mouth of the bag to his lips. He was stunned and said, "I'll do it myself."

Jinghe gave him the water. His hand was weak, so he managed to hold it and take a sip, but he choked and coughed.

Jinghe took out a handkerchief and wiped the corners of his mouth. He looked at it and smiled with red eyes, "You still like to embroider green pines on handkerchiefs."

"Yeah!" Jinghe nodded slightly, pursed her chapped lips, "Qingsong is good, tenacious."

King Wei took a gentle breath and said, "Where are you going next? Are you going back to the capital?"

"I don't know." Jinghe's eyes were a little dazed. There were places where she left and she didn't want to go back. There were too many things she didn't want to remember.

King Wei really wanted her to follow him back to Jiangbei Mansion, but when the words came to his lips, he felt that he was not qualified to say them.

In the past two years, he always thought of the time when they were together. He always thought that she was reluctant to be with him. After all, it was his recklessness that forced her away, and she had no choice but to marry him.

At that time, he had always wanted to tell her that since the first time he saw her, he would not marry her unless she wanted to move her and warm her up, but he was not a talkative or coaxing person, and those performances were really terrible when he thought about it.

"What about you?" Jinghe took a deep breath and looked at him, "Where are you going?"

King Wei recovered his thoughts and said: "I'm going back to Jiangbei Mansion. I am now stationed in Jiangbei Mansion with the fourth child. By the way, the fourth child's wife is also there. She is pregnant."

Jinghe smiled slightly, her eyebrows curved, "I'm really happy for her."

This smile was almost fatal to King Wei. The first time he saw her, she smiled like this with crooked eyebrows.

He stared at it for a moment, then suddenly felt courage in his heart, "You..."

"Lao San, are you feeling better?" King An strode over at this moment and asked.

King Wei was discouraged and looked at him unhappy, "Much better."

King An sat down, but he looked a little happy, "I tell you, don't be discouraged. I just talked with General Jingting for a while, and it turned out that his broken arm was connected. Prince Qingtian Regent of the Great Zhou Dynasty knew this.

I'll take you to Dazhou later and beg him to pick up your arm."

"Really?" Jinghe's eyes suddenly lit up.

King An nodded, but didn't dare to look at Jinghe.

Jinghe then said to King Wei: "This way you can go to the Great Zhou Dynasty. You are a military general. It will be very inconvenient if you have a broken arm. It would be great if you can reconnect it."

King Wei looked at the joy in her eyes, and his heart blossomed unconsciously, "If you want me to pick you up, I will ask Regent Qingtian."

Jinghe looked at the confusion in his eyes, turned her head and said softly: "You broke your arm to save me after all. If you can reconnect it, at least I can feel more at ease when I leave."

King Wei looked at her blankly, the flowers in his heart quickly withered, and a layer of gloom came over his eyes, and he said: "Forget it, it's a long way to go to the Great Zhou Dynasty, not to mention that the regent Shenlong has never seen his head.

, I can’t leave Jiangbei Mansion for too long, so I won’t go.”
